红黑树在重新平衡自身时是否会修改其叶子从左到右的顺序?

Does a Red-Black Tree modify the left-to-right order of its leaves when it re-balances itself?

换句话说,如果你在插入后立即从左到右读取红黑树中叶子的值,那么在对树执行平衡操作后,该顺序是否保持不变?

Re-balancing 可以使一个节点的兄弟节点成为新的 parent,但它不能改变相对顺序。请记住,red-black 树是一棵二叉搜索树,因此它应该在其左子树中保留小于给定元素的元素,在其右子树中保留比给定元素大的元素。交换顶点的 children 将反转不等式。